This Panther Ausf A has been abandoned in front of Cologne Cathedral during the German retreat.

This author originally incorrectly identified this tank as an Ausf G, taking the straight edge to the side of the hull as his guide. Many thanks to Walter White for pointing out the presence of the vision hatch at the far right of the picture, suggesting that this should be an Ausf A. Close examination of the original picture reveals some traces of the 'kink' at the rear of the tank, confirming that identification.
